Astragalus membranaceus Injection Suppresses Production of Interleukin-6 by Activating Autophagy through the AMPK-mTOR Pathway in Lipopolysaccharide-Stimulated Macrophages

Figure 4

AM can mitigate the inhibitory effect of LPS on autophagy in ANA-1 cells. (a, c) Green-stained LC3 and green-stained p62 of ANA-1 cells in different groups as shown in the immunofluorescence assay (FITC-labeled goat anti-mouse IgG, LC3 antibody and p62 antibody for basement antibody). (b) Percentage of LC3 punctated cells. (e–g) Western blot analysis of the changes in the levels of LC3 and p62 proteins in ANA cells induced by different doses of AM at different coincubation times with or without LPS. β-Actin was used as the control.
